[ QUOTE ]
Now that I've logged 10K hands in my shiny new Pokertracker, I can say that I'm proud to be one of the few losing players in this thread. The swing doesn't bother me, most of it consists of a BASTARD shot at 100NL and a ton of coolers, beats, and I counted 2 tilt stackoffs and some more questionable hands that I've reviewed. My main question in this thread regards my turn and river aggro factors. I think this has to do with a couple tendencies that may or may not be leaks

1) I almost never 2 barrel (Prob not a leak at 50NL)

You should get used to it on 50NL, even lower, you need it for higher stakes and as an extra move

2) I rarely float (Also prob not a leak)

You should against the right villains, huge +EV

3) With marginal TPGK type hands I like to wait for the river to get value (Leak?)

Yes

4) I suck at value betting thin (Def a leak)

correct

Also I was a cbet crazed moran for most of this stretch, so my flop AF is abnormally high. I've calmed that down somewhat.



[/ QUOTE ]

[ QUOTE ]
please don't break the stats thread by quoting large images multiple times kthnx. - matrix

[/ QUOTE ]



our stats are pretty similar...

1. i dont 2nd barrel much either, against most 25/50NL villains they just cant let down TPWK and even midpair sometimes...when i think im playin against a dec villian i will fire again if a scare card hits but on the most part dont fire often (a leak if so help please!!)

2. The only ppl i float are decent players that cbet alot and cbet turn low, though i dont do it very often...useually dont find many good chances too (should I start finding more?).

3. w/ marginal TPGK hands hit on the flop i def bet if called i usually slow down on the turn but this is villian dependent as well, if villian checks on turn then i value bet the river alot.

4. i use not to value bet much myself but i have been doing it alot more frequently and its great!

well my flop AF is even larger than yours but i dont get in many situations 2 handed where i dont cbet, only time i dont is if villian is a callin station and my hand sucks bad, 3+ handed only cbet if i hit hard, or already have a hand or if im in position and all villians fold to cbet alot. maybe im too aggro on the flop?? but i like it [img]/images/graemlins/smile.gif[/img]

but you def have not logged in enough hands to tell if your a losing player so just keep grindin!
